Six Arrests Made as Officers Seize Drugs in Major Operation
Metropolitan Police officers have carried out a series of raids targeting drug dealing in Kingston and Merton, leading to six arrests. The operation, conducted on Wednesday, February 5, 2025, focused on disrupting criminal activity on the Cambridge Road Estate and beyond.
Operation Overview
Six properties were raided, including a fast-food restaurant on Surbiton Crescent and multiple residential addresses.
Officers seized heroin, cocaine, and other drugs during the searches.
Six people were arrested—three men, one woman, and two teenage boys—all of whom remain in police custody.
This targeted approach has contributed to the Met being removed from special measures in January 2025, following improvements in neighbourhood policing, child exploitation prevention, and public protection.
What’s Next?
The investigation is ongoing, and further arrests may follow.
